A. O. Smith Corporation Declares Quarterly Dividend: A Signal of Financial Stability

MILWAUKEE, WI – July 7, 2025 – A. O. Smith Corporation (NYSE: AOS), a leading global manufacturer of water heaters and boilers, today announced that its Board of Directors has declared a regular quarterly cash dividend of $0.34 per share. This dividend will be paid on both the company's Common Stock and Class A Common Stock, underscoring the company's consistent commitment to returning value to its shareholders.

Market Context and Industry Position

A. O. Smith operates in the essential home and commercial building products sector, specifically in water heating and treatment. This industry is characterized by relatively stable demand, driven by new construction, replacement cycles, and increasing global demand for clean water and energy-efficient solutions. The company's strong brand recognition, extensive distribution network, and focus on innovation in areas like smart water heaters and advanced filtration systems position it well within this market.

Despite potential economic headwinds, the necessity of hot water and clean water ensures a baseline demand for A. O. Smith's products. Furthermore, the company's global footprint, with significant operations in North America, China, and India, diversifies its revenue streams and mitigates regional economic risks. The Chinese market, in particular, has been a significant growth driver for A. O. Smith in recent years, though it also presents unique competitive dynamics.

Financial Implications and Investor Insights

The declaration of a regular quarterly dividend signals that A. O. Smith's management believes the company has sufficient cash flow and profitability to sustain these payouts. For investors, this can imply several things:

  • Financial Stability: A consistent dividend history often points to a company with strong balance sheets and predictable earnings.
  • Shareholder Return Focus: It demonstrates a commitment to returning capital to shareholders, which can enhance total shareholder return, especially for long-term holders.
  • Confidence in Future Performance: Management's decision to maintain or increase dividends often reflects optimism about future operational performance and market conditions.

Investors considering A. O. Smith should look beyond just the dividend yield. Analyzing the company's dividend payout ratio (dividends per share divided by earnings per share) can indicate the sustainability of the dividend. A lower payout ratio suggests more room for future dividend growth and less risk of a cut. Furthermore, examining the company's free cash flow generation is crucial, as dividends are ultimately paid from cash.
